news 2026/5/4 13:15:08

Vue3-Element-Admin终极解决方案:企业级后台管理系统的完整框架

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Vue3-Element-Admin终极解决方案:企业级后台管理系统的完整框架

Vue3-Element-Admin终极解决方案:企业级后台管理系统的完整框架

【免费下载链接】vue3-element-adminvue3-element-admin后台管理系统前端解决方案项目地址: https://gitcode.com/gh_mirrors/vue/vue3-element-admin

在数字化转型浪潮中,企业后台管理系统开发面临着效率低下、技术债务累积和成本控制难题。vue3-element-admin作为基于Vue3和Element Plus的完整企业级框架,通过零配置快速部署和智能化权限管理,为企业提供了终极解决方案。

技术痛点:传统后台开发的效率瓶颈

传统后台系统开发往往陷入重复造轮子的困境:权限控制逻辑复杂、多设备适配困难、团队协作效率低下。据统计,企业开发团队平均需要投入40%的开发时间在基础架构搭建上,而非核心业务功能实现。

💡关键问题分析

  • 权限管理复杂度高:多角色权限控制需要大量重复代码
  • 响应式适配困难:不同设备显示效果参差不齐
  • 技术债务累积:缺乏标准化架构导致维护成本激增

核心优势:重新定义开发效率的技术矩阵

智能化权限控制系统

vue3-element-admin通过动态路由生成机制(src/router/modules)和细粒度权限管控,实现多角色权限的自动化管理。系统根据用户角色实时过滤并加载对应菜单,确保管理员、运营、财务等不同权限用户看到专属功能界面。

模块化架构设计

采用"中枢神经+分支系统"的架构理念:

  • 调度核心层:路由管理(src/router)与状态管理(src/pinia)构成系统大脑
  • 业务组件层:可复用组件(src/components)和页面视图(src/views)实现功能快速组装
  • 数据交互层:API封装(src/api)提供安全高效的数据传输通道

性能优化引擎

基于Vue3的组合式API架构,系统实现了60%的代码冗余减少。配合Vite构建工具的热更新机制,代码修改后100ms内即可看到效果,开发效率提升3倍。

应用场景:多维度企业需求全覆盖

中大型企业后台管理系统

当企业组织架构调整时,系统可通过后端接口实时更新菜单权限,无需前端重新打包。在src/pinia/modules/menu.js中,generateMenus方法会根据用户角色动态加载路由配置。

多租户SaaS平台

支持多语言无缝切换(src/i18n),满足跨国企业多语言办公需求。响应式界面在移动设备上自动转换为紧凑布局(src/layout/components/Sidebar),确保用户体验一致性。

快速上线业务系统

标签页导航功能(src/layout/components/Tagsbar)提供类似浏览器标签的页面管理体验,支持快速切换与关闭操作。

实施指南:从零到一的快速部署策略

技术选型对比分析

评估维度vue3-element-admin传统自研方案其他开源模板
ROI开箱即用,节省80%基础开发时间需从零构建权限系统功能固定,定制成本高
TCO活跃社区支持,持续迭代更新需自行维护所有依赖文档简陋,问题解决周期长
扩展性模块化设计,支持按需集成架构耦合度高,扩展困难定制化需大幅修改源码

快速启动流程

通过以下命令实现零配置快速部署:

git clone https://gitcode.com/gh_mirrors/vue/vue3-element-admin cd vue3-element-admin npm install npm run dev

系统将自动打开浏览器展示初始登录界面,默认提供完善的演示数据与功能示例,帮助技术团队快速理解项目架构。

最佳实践建议

  1. 权限配置优化:利用src/pinia/modules/account.js中的用户信息管理机制,实现权限的精细化控制

  2. 界面定制策略:通过src/assets/style中的全局变量配置,快速实现品牌视觉的统一

  3. 性能监控部署:集成错误日志系统(src/components/ErrorLog),确保系统稳定性

价值体现:可量化的商业效益

开发效率提升

对比传统开发模式,vue3-element-admin能够减少80%的基础开发时间,让技术团队专注于核心业务逻辑实现。

维护成本控制

模块化架构设计有效降低技术债务,相比自研方案减少60%的维护工作量。

投资回报分析

  • 开发周期缩短:从6个月压缩至1个月
  • 人力成本节约:减少2-3名前端开发人员投入
  • 上线风险降低:基于成熟框架,避免技术选型失误

未来展望:智能化后台开发的演进路径

随着Vue3生态的持续成熟,vue3-element-admin将在AI辅助开发、自动化测试和性能监控方面不断进化,为企业提供更加智能高效的后台开发体验。

选择vue3-element-admin不仅是技术决策,更是企业数字化转型的战略选择。这套完整的企业级框架将成为企业后台系统开发的终极解决方案,助力企业在竞争激烈的市场中保持技术领先优势。

【免费下载链接】vue3-element-adminvue3-element-admin后台管理系统前端解决方案项目地址: https://gitcode.com/gh_mirrors/vue/vue3-element-admin

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/28 19:43:32

零基础掌握Proteus 8 Professional电路绘图技巧

从零开始玩转Proteus:手把手教你画出第一个能仿真的电路你有没有过这样的经历?想做个智能小灯,代码写好了,却因为接错一个电阻烧了单片机;或者调试DS18B20温度传感器时,程序明明没错,可就是读不…

作者头像 李华
网站建设 2026/4/25 12:06:59

小红书数据采集实战:从入门到精通的Python解决方案

小红书数据采集实战:从入门到精通的Python解决方案 【免费下载链接】xhs 基于小红书 Web 端进行的请求封装。https://reajason.github.io/xhs/ 项目地址: https://gitcode.com/gh_mirrors/xh/xhs 在数字化营销时代,小红书作为内容电商的重要阵地&…

作者头像 李华
网站建设 2026/4/23 13:02:36

NBTExplorer终极指南:3步掌握我的世界数据编辑

NBTExplorer终极指南:3步掌握我的世界数据编辑 【免费下载链接】NBTExplorer A graphical NBT editor for all Minecraft NBT data sources 项目地址: https://gitcode.com/gh_mirrors/nb/NBTExplorer 你是否曾经好奇为什么别人的《我的世界》存档总是充满惊…

作者头像 李华
网站建设 2026/5/2 4:25:36

BGE-Large-zh-v1.5中文嵌入模型实战指南:从零到精通

还在为中文文本检索的准确性发愁吗?🤔 想知道如何让AI真正理解你的中文文档内容?今天我们就来深入探索BGE-Large-zh-v1.5这个中文嵌入模型的强大功能,让你在中文NLP领域游刃有余! 【免费下载链接】bge-large-zh-v1.5 …

作者头像 李华
网站建设 2026/5/4 1:34:37

Zotero中文文献管理难题的终极解决方案

还在为手动整理海量中文文献而头疼吗?每次添加新论文都要重复输入作者、期刊、年份这些基本信息?Jasminum插件正是为你量身打造的文献管理神器! 【免费下载链接】jasminum A Zotero add-on to retrive CNKI meta data. 一个简单的Zotero 插件…

作者头像 李华